I've just renewed for my '56 plate D3.

Previously with Adrian Flux, £330ish for the year, this years renewal came through at £490. surprised to say the least, Shopped around and ended up with Hastings direct for £340.

9-10K per annum
overnight on street parking
10 years NCB
1 x SP30 3 years ago

Just about to renew the fleet - ALPINA, Espace and Polo - with Admiral.

As usual, the initial renewal quote was laughable but 20 minutes later and it is cheaper than last year :D

I won't bore you with the details for all the cars except to say that I will be insuring the B3S Touring for £295 for the next year (20,000 miles, Business use and agreed value of £13,000)
